Originally Posted by ViGlJo View Post
Are there any Digital TV tuner/video capture cards that work well with SLED?
Goal: Linux entertainment center
There are cards which work with Linux and therefore should work with SLED though additional packages may be required. E.g. LinuxTVWiki


I've never tried doing it, but if I wanted to make a Linux entrainment centre then I wouldn't even consider using SLED as I imagine there'd be more mucking around with extra repos and stuff to get all the necessary packages than if you went with another distro that hasn't been packaged with an Enterprise environment specifically in mind. I'd start with openSUSE or Ubuntu then look at adding MythTV or XMBC. Or there's Mythbuntu.

Put "SLED media center" and "Ubuntu media center" in to Google and compare the results!
